Each parent is entitled to 160 working days of maternity leave, which must be taken before the child turns 2. Working parents can use the parental leave in a maximum of four periods, with each period lasting at least 12 days. One parent can transfer up to 63 days of parental leave to the other parent. As stated on InfoFinland, a website maintained by the City of Helsinki, single parents can use the full 320 working days of parental leave.
